Is there any indication that the company will announce strategic initiatives or partnerships at the fireside chats?

Answer

Based on the information provided in the news release, there is no explicit indication that Shift4 (NYSE: FOUR) plans to announce new strategic initiatives or partnerships during the upcoming fireside chats.

Why the release does not suggest such announcements

Element in the release What it says Implication
Event description “Management will participate in a fireside chat at the virtual 2025 Susquehanna Get Carded Conference
 Management will also be available for one‑on‑one and small group meetings.” The wording is purely logistical—telling investors when and how management will be reachable. It does not mention any planned content, such as product launches, partnership reveals, or strategic roadmap updates.
Absence of forward‑looking language No phrases like “we will unveil,” “we look forward to announcing,” “strategic initiatives,” or “new partnerships” are present. In corporate communications, any intention to make a public announcement of a major initiative is typically highlighted with forward‑looking language (e.g., “We will share updates on our growth strategy”). The lack of such language suggests no planned public disclosure at these sessions.
Purpose of the event The release categorizes the news under Investor and frames the fireside chat as a “fireside chat” and a venue for “one‑on‑one and small group meetings.” Fireside chats at investor conferences are generally used for management‑investor dialogue, earnings discussion, and answering analyst questions. While they can be a platform for unveiling new initiatives, the release does not state that this is the intent for these particular sessions.
Timing and context The events are scheduled for August 12, 2025 and September 10, 2025—both relatively close to the release date (August 8, 2025). If a major partnership or strategic plan were to be announced, companies often issue a separate press release or include a “preview” in the invitation. No such preview is present here.

What this means for investors and analysts

  • No guaranteed new disclosures: Investors should not assume that a strategic partnership or initiative will be revealed solely because a fireside chat is scheduled. The company may discuss existing performance, outlook, or operational updates, but any new, material announcements would require a separate, explicit communication.
  • Potential for informal discussion: While the release does not promise new announcements, fireside chats can still be a venue where management discusses upcoming strategic directions in a non‑public, one‑on‑one setting. Analysts who secure a meeting may obtain insights that are not disclosed publicly, but those insights would remain private unless the company later issues a formal announcement.
  • Monitoring subsequent communications: If Shift4 later decides to announce a partnership or strategic initiative, it would likely be communicated through a dedicated press release, an SEC filing (e.g., Form 8‑K), or an update on the investor‑relations website. Keeping an eye on those channels after the conference dates is advisable.

Bottom line

  • No direct statement in the release indicates that Shift4 will announce strategic initiatives or partnerships at the fireside chats.
  • The events are presented as general investor‑relations opportunities (fireside chats and meeting slots) without any hint of a planned public disclosure of new strategic moves.

Therefore, based solely on the provided news information, we cannot conclude that the company intends to announce strategic initiatives or partnerships during these fireside chats. If such announcements are forthcoming, they would be communicated through a separate, dedicated announcement.
